- Paid Maternity LeaveYour ResponsibilitiesStaff Development and
Leadership
- Provide leadership and coaching for staff performance and
foster a positive and productive team environment.
- Assist with attracting, hiring, retaining and training
exceptional team members.
- Ensure all onsite staff are trained and compliant with Fair
Housing, safety and company policies.
- Manage the development of and adherence to the property onsite
schedule, including after hour on-call shifts.Property
Administration
- Prepare, respond and advise on all community aspects including
market, physical condition, policies, procedures and onsite
emergencies.
- Deliver legal and resident notices and files evictions in
compliance with current policy and local ordinances.
- Assist with planning and leading the team in executing
successful annual Turnover processes.
- Manage all resident accounts and utility billing, coordinate
accounts receivables, and maintain regular auditing and
documenting.
- Ensures move-in, room assignments, transfer and move-out
processes are executed efficiently and successfully.Facilities &
Capital
- Responsible for safe and sanitary community experience for
employees, residents and guests including property appearance,
operationally sound facilities, preventative maintenance and great
service.
- Responsible for property curb appeal and overall appearance of
building exterior, common areas, amenities, and apartments.
- Assist with conducting inspections and walk vacant
apartments/bed spaces monthly.
- Regularly inspect grounds, interior and resident amenities /
general common areas to ensure that the facilities comply with all
codes and company standards.
- Coordinate work order requests with appropriate staff or
vendors.Financial Performance
- Assist in the preparation of Month End reports, reconcile, and
balance all accounts receivable.
- Enforce and comply with all Scion late fees, Non-Sufficient
Funds (NSF) fees and collection policies, keeping delinquency below
2% by month end.
- Post and collect damage charges from quarterly
inspections.
- Assess damage at move-out to calculate required charges and
prepare final billing or processes refunds.Customer Experience &
Sales
- Manage all customer sales interactions, both personally and
through directing team members in alignment with company
standards.
- Perform weekly market surveys.
- Manage the successful execution of customer experience
initiatives, engagement initiatives, and additional marketing
opportunities.
- Manage promotional material and property incentives meeting
marketing and concession budget.
- Provide expert direction on sales and revenue goals and lead
the team to achieve them. Utilize KPIs to report on trends,
insights and proactively address issues.
- Identify and recommend local marketing opportunities,
appropriate marketing messages and material to drive traffic to the
property.
- Manage all escalated resident concerns and account matters in a
timely manner.The responsibilities listed above may not be all
inclusive.What We Require
- Exceptional written and verbal communicator
- Meticulous detail orientation
- Customer-centric mindset
- 1+ years' experience working at living communities/property
management
- Proficient in Property Management Systems (Entrata
preferred)Operational Details
